The Catuai Variety — Sweet, Balanced, Dependable
Catuai is a prized Arabica variety developed from a cross of Mundo Novo and Caturra. Compact and resilient, it thrives at the high altitudes of Boquete and is loved for a naturally sweet, well-rounded cup with gentle acidity. This is the yellow-fruited selection, Catuaí Amarillo, hand-picked at peak ripeness and finished with the washed process for a clean, defined flavor.
Washed Process — Clean and Defined
In the washed process, the coffee cherry's fruit and mucilage are removed before drying, so what reaches your cup is the pure character of the bean and its terroir. The result is a bright, transparent cup with crisp acidity and a clean finish — the ideal way to show off Catuai's chocolate and hazelnut sweetness.
Four Generations of Boquete Coffee
The Gran Del Val story began in 1880, when French engineer Joseph De Dianous arrived in Panama to work on the French Canal Company. In 1914 his son Gabriel purchased land in Bajo Mono and founded Farm Gladys. Over a century later, the De Dianous-Fernandez family is still here, still farming, and in 1997 built Panama's first ecological coffee processing mill — pioneering sustainable specialty coffee in the region.
Where the Coffee Grows
Grown in the volcanic highlands of Boquete, Chiriquí — where the cool mountain climate, rich volcanic soil from Volcán Barú, and the famous Bajareque mist create the ideal microclimate for slow, even cherry maturation and deep sweetness.

How to Brew
Use filtered water at 200°F (93°C). If you ordered whole bean, grind just before brewing for the freshest cup.
- Pour-Over (V60 / Chemex) — Ratio 1:15 | 3–4 min. Best for the citrus and chocolate notes.
- Drip / Filter — Ratio 1:17 | 5–6 min. Clean and balanced for everyday.
- French Press — Ratio 1:15 | 4 min. Rounds out the body and nutty sweetness.
Tip: Store the bag tightly sealed in a cool, dry place. Use within 3–4 weeks of opening for peak freshness.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the Catuai coffee variety?
Catuai is an Arabica variety bred from Mundo Novo and Caturra. It grows well at high altitude and is known for a sweet, balanced, easy-drinking cup. This is the yellow selection, Catuaí Amarillo.
What does Gran Del Val Catuai taste like?
Chocolate, honey, hazelnut, and citrus. Smooth and sweet with a medium body, gentle acidity, and a clean finish.
What is the washed process?
The cherry's fruit is removed before drying, producing a clean, bright cup that highlights the bean's natural sweetness and clarity.
